What does a driver helper do?

As a driver helper, your duties are to help a delivery driver to load and unload their truck and accompany them on the route from the warehouse or shipping facility to customers. Your specific responsibilities also include helping to prepare and store equipment, such as hand trucks and dollies for moving large packages. Many driver helpers work for the large parcel delivery services, such as UPS, FedEx, and DHL, and they are often entry-level jobs where you get training before you can work as a delivery person yourself.

What is a driver helper?

Driver Helpers assist delivery drivers with loading, unloading, and delivering packages, especially during busy seasons. They typically ride along with the driver, help carry packages to customers' doors, and ensure deliveries are completed efficiently and safely. This role often requires physical stamina, good customer service skills, and the ability to work in various weather conditions. Driver Helpers do not drive the vehicle themselves but are essential in supporting timely deliveries.

Driver Helpers assist drivers with loading, unloading, and delivery tasks, often without requiring a commercial driver's license. Delivery Drivers operate vehicles to deliver goods directly to customers, usually holding a valid driver's license and sometimes specific endorsements. Both roles are integral to the logistics and delivery industry, but Driver Helpers focus on support tasks, while Delivery Drivers handle the driving and customer interaction.

What are some typical challenges faced by driver helpers during peak delivery seasons?

During peak delivery seasons, such as holidays, Driver Helpers often encounter increased package volumes and tight delivery schedules. This can mean longer hours, more physically demanding work, and the need to adapt quickly to changing routes or weather conditions. Effective communication with the driver and strong organizational skills are crucial to ensure timely and accurate deliveries. Staying positive and maintaining a team-oriented attitude help in managing the fast-paced environment.
